• word of the day

    window frame

    window frame - Dictionary definition and meaning for word window frame

    Definition
    (noun) the framework that supports a window

Word used in video below:
text: frame the climbing frame is quite High
Download our Mobile App Today
Receive our word of the day
on Whatsapp